Unlike a physical fence, a camera does not just deter; it records. It creates a permanent digital archive of movement, habits, and relationships. This creates the central paradox of modern security: To protect your private space, you may have to invade the privacy of the public space—and risk exposing your own private data to hackers or corporations.
